Snack - Based Troubleshooting and Repair Guide
1670065 Page 30 of 54 September, 2002
DBV.COMM
Incomplete bill valida-
tor communications.
1. Check harness(es).
Bad bill validator. 2. Replace bill validator.
Bill
Validator on
page 51
DBV.JAM
A bill is jammed in the
acceptance path.
1. Remove bill stuck in the accep-
tance path.
2. Cycle machine power OFF and
then ON.
DBV.MOTOR
One of the validator
motors has failed.
1. Check for bill stuck in the accep-
tance path.
a. Remove bill, then cycle machine
power OFF then ON.
2. If no bill is present, replace the val-
idator.
a. Cycle machine power OFF and
then ON.
Bill
Validator on
page 51
DBV.ROM
ROM checksum fail-
ure.
1. Replace the validator.
Bill
Validator on
page 51
DBV.SENSOR
One of the sensors in
the bill validator has
failed.
1. Check for bill stuck in the accep-
tance path.
a. Remove bill, then cycle machine
power OFF then ON.
1. If no bill is present, replace the val-
idator.
a. Cycle machine power OFF and
then ON.
Bill
Validator on
page 51
DBV.STACKR
The stacker is open or
removed.
1. Install the stacker correctly.
The stacker is full of
bills.
1. Remove bills from the stacker.
ERR A B C
(etc.)
Error exists on tray A,
B, C, etc.
Motor may be
jammed, not home, or
a couple error exists.
1. Swap tray with a known working
tray.
Tray Rails
on page 45
a. If problem is cleared, check tray
motors, harnesses, etc.
b. If problem persists, check tray
block, machine harness or inter-
face PCB.
Tray Rails
on page 45
Table 2. Possible Failures (Diagnostic Messages) - Continued
